Output feeb4b606393f1555c9dfbe355b3fe15dcbcd25c0361284a466cdf171228154c:1

value
104886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89b74d28a0f71e9fc579e41d7b1504e83ba91af OP_EQUAL
address
3QMXjQvuQ54BHzg5vtMBzHoS2J7HB4cFu7
transaction
feeb4b606393f1555c9dfbe355b3fe15dcbcd25c0361284a466cdf171228154c
spent
true